Growth Picture Improves

Despite a flattening in consumer confidence in the US, growth in the American economy improved in the third quarter of 2017. GDP for the second quarter was revised upward from 2.2% to 3.1%. Corporate earnings accelerated in the third quarter for the S&P 500 to over 17%. Consumer confidence which hit a 17 year high in March 2017, has since eased back modestly. The change in trend for consumer confidence is difficult to quantify but it is likely due to politics in Washington and the country’s inability to come together since the election.Read more
